Lambda Pi Eta
Omicron Upsilon Chapter
ΛΠΕ is the official communication studies honor society of the National Communication
Association (NCA). As an accredited member of the Association of College Honor
Societies (ACHS), ΛΠΕ has nearly 420 active chapters at colleges and universities
worldwide.
ΛΠΕ was founded in 1985 at the University of
Arkansas. ΛΠΕ became a part of the National Communication Association
(NCA) in 1988, and the official honor
society of the NCA in 1995.
ΛΠΕ represents what Aristotle described in his book, Rhetoric, as the three
ingredients of persuasion: Logos (Lambda) meaning logic, Pathos (Pi) relating
to emotion, and Ethos (Eta) defined as character credibility and ethics.
The goals of ΛΠΕ are to:
1. Recognize, foster and reward outstanding scholastic achievement in communication
studies;
2. Stimulate interest in the field of communication;
3. Promote and encourage professional development among communication majors;
4. Provide an opportunity to discuss and exchange ideas in the field of communication;
5. Establish and maintain closer relationships between faculty and students;
and
6. Explore options for graduate education in communication studies.
In order to become a member of a Lambda Pi Eta chapter, the student must:
1. have completed at least 60 semester hours in college;
2. have completed at least 12 semester hours of communication study;
3. have a cumulative GPA of at least 3.0;
4. have a communication studies GPA of at least 3.25;
5. be currently enrolled as a student in good standing;
6. display commitment to the field of communication.
